Defensor asked the Inter-Agency Task Force to reconsider the 5,000 annual limit for newly hired local healthcare workers who may be permitted to leave the country for overseas employment.
“If they’ve already received hiring notices from foreign employers, we should just allow them to leave,” added the House Health Committee vice chairperson. He stressed that “every Filipino enjoys the right to sell his or her skills to the best employer here or abroad that will offer the greatest reward.”
Nurses comprise the largest group of newly hired healthcare workers leaving the country every year, according to the Philippine Overseas Employment Administration.
